Comprehending Your Parts Options
Before selecting a dealer, it helps to understand the classifications of parts readily available on the marketplace. Various dealers specialize in different types of elements, and the ideal choice depends on budget, automobile age, and repair goals.
O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) Parts: These are made by Mopar, the main parts division for Ram. They correspond the parts that featured the truck off the assembly line.
Aftermarket Parts: Manufactured by third-party business. These can vary from budget-friendly replacements to high-performance upgrades that go beyond factory requirements.
